Subject: Handover — Skylark GraphQL N+1 fix

Hi Merel,

The resolver batching for the Skylark catalog service is merged and verified on staging. DataLoader now coalesces product-variant lookups, cutting query counts from ~400 to 3 per request. Please keep an eye on pool saturation during the first hour post-release. To verify against the staging replica, use the connection string below.

primary connection of tajeg-tajop = postgresql://julax_svc:DI@db-e7f3.kelvidyn.corp:5432/rusdor

**Memo: Pilot churn — Sales Leads**

Quick one: the Fernhollow pilot lost six of forty accounts last month, mostly smaller shops citing onboarding friction. Not a fire, but worth watching. We're pairing each remaining account with a success rep through quarter-end. Please flag any wobbly customers early rather than late. The planning implications are summarized below.

internal memo for kawip-hadug: Headcount on the Wenwyn team goes from 7 to 140 by the end of January. Gross margin on Wenwyn came in at 20 percent against a plan of 15 percent.

Hello all,

As of this week, Typeloft no longer fetches fonts from remote foundry endpoints at render time. All licensed families are now vendored into the release bundle and served from the local asset store. This removes the flaky network dependency several of you reported and makes builds reproducible. Plugins referencing remote font URLs will get the vendored equivalent automatically; unknown families fall back to the system stack. Your plugin runtime now starts with the following configuration.

settings of bahop-kaweg:
[novael]
host = novael.braskstack.example
user = novael_svc
database = novael_prod

## Env Vars — Routefox Driver Assignment

Heuristic weights live in ASSIGN_WEIGHT_DISTANCE, ASSIGN_WEIGHT_RATING, ASSIGN_WEIGHT_IDLE. All read at boot; no runtime mutation. Scoring service runs isolated, no PII beyond driver ID. Audit log of assignments retained 30 days. Review focus: the scoring API is authenticated per-request, and the signing secret it uses is set on the line below.

vault entry, yahif-yajep: COURIER_KEY29=b802bdf8034096b65a51c6ba5abe2